Summary: | This video presents a lecture by Patricia Arrendondo, Arizona State University, on the counseling of Latinos and Latino families. Latinos are multi-generational, inter- ethnic, immigrant, and the fastest growing population in the U.S. The lecture includes the following topics: demographics, cultural values and world views, personal and family identity, societal stressors, healthcare orientations, and contemporary issues. Includes case examples with proposed interventions. |
